Essential Techniques for Major Site Verification


There are a quantity of strategies users can make use of to verify major websites, each tailoring to different features of safety and trustworthiness. One of the primary methods entails checking for the presence of secure socket layer (SSL) certification, which is indicated by a padlock image within the browser's tackle bar. SSL certificates encrypt knowledge transferred between the user's browser and the online server, making certain that sensitive information remains protected against interception. Furthermore, reviewing the positioning's privateness policy can lend perception into how consumer information shall be handled. A clear coverage should clearly define what information is collected, how it is used, and the measures taken to guard it.


In addition to those technical checks, inspecting user evaluations and scores can provide valuable perception right into a website's legitimacy. Platforms like Trustpilot and SiteJabber aggregate user feedback, allowing potential users to gauge the experiences of others. It is essential, nonetheless, to evaluate the authenticity of reviews—looking for patterns in the suggestions might help determine whether a web site is genuinely well-regarded or if the reviews are being manipulated.

Utilizing Third-Party Verification Services


Another efficient approach to confirm a website's credibility is to utilize third-party verification services that specialize in assessing on-line platforms. These organizations conduct thorough audits, checking for security measures, regulatory compliance, and person knowledge dealing with practices. For occasion, sites like Norton Safe Web and McAfee WebAdvisor provide ratings primarily based on security analyses, letting users know if a website is secure to visit. Employing such independent providers can present a further layer of assurance when navigating the vast on-line landscape.

Cautionary Flags: Recognizing Red Flags on Major Sites


Becoming acquainted with common red flags can significantly enhance a user's capability to determine potential threats. Some common warning signs include poor website design, excessive pop-up ads, or unprofessional language and spelling errors in the website's content. Sites that pressure users into making hasty selections or that supply deals that appear too good to be true sometimes warrant a careful examination. all these components mixed can typically be indicative of a less-than-reputable site. Additionally, respectable companies normally provide clear contact data and customer assist choices. A lack of such particulars should elevate alarms for users.

The Role of Regulations and Licensing in Site Verification


Legal laws and licensing are important elements within the realm of online platforms, significantly in sectors like online playing or financial providers. Users should always examine if a web site is licensed by an appropriate regulatory body. In the playing business, for example, jurisdictions just like the UK Gambling Commission and the Malta Gaming Authority enforce strict laws. A licensed web site should adhere to established requirements, offering the next level of safety and fairness. Implementing Personal Security Practices


While verifying a site's legitimacy is important, adopting private safety practices is equally important. Ensuring that your units are geared up with up-to-date antivirus software, enabling firewalls, and using strong passwords may help protect against potential threats. Moreover, employing two-factor authentication every time attainable provides an additional layer of security, ensuring that even when private info is compromised, unauthorized entry is tougher.
